Compartment syndrome monitoring devices are pivotal in managing and diagnosing compartment syndrome, a condition characterized by increased pressure within muscles, leading to muscle and nerve damage. These devices play a crucial role in the healthcare value chain by providing real-time pressure monitoring, which aids in timely intervention and prevention of irreversible damage. The primary applications are in hospitals, ambulatory surgical centers, and sports medicine. There is a growing trend toward minimally invasive monitoring solutions, driven by technological advancements and the increasing incidence of trauma cases globally. Demand is fueled by rising awareness among healthcare professionals and patients about the importance of early diagnosis and intervention, although challenges persist in terms of high costs and the need for skilled professionals to operate these devices.

The competitive landscape is marked by the presence of several key players focusing on product innovation and strategic partnerships to enhance their market presence. Companies are investing in research and development to introduce advanced devices with enhanced accuracy and user-friendliness. Regionally, North America and Europe dominate the market due to advanced healthcare infrastructure and high healthcare expenditure. However, the Asia-Pacific region is witnessing significant growth momentum, attributed to rising healthcare investments and a large patient population. Regulatory standards and compliance requirements vary by region, posing challenges for market entry and expansion. Despite these hurdles, the market is poised for growth, driven by technological advancements and increasing demand for effective monitoring solutions.
